With the rapid development of housing industrialization, there is a great needof new management methods for prefabricated housing supply chain management,which the traditional methods cannot solve efficiently. Prefabricated housingcomponent (PHC) is the basic component of the prefabricated houses, whosetracking management the main part of construction supply chain management,which can sharply improve the level of information sharing, strengthen thecooperation between node organizations, which also has a great influence onproject schedule, cost and quality management.Prefabricated housing construction organizations will be the researchbackground in this paper. Social network analysis (SNA) is used for organizationand network centrality analysis, which has been found that construction enterprisesare in the central of the network. In the construction enterprises, install, scheduleand materials manage departments have high centralities, which are the conductorof PHC tracking management. Quality control, distribution and yard location arethe key control point of PHC tracking management.Radio frequency identification (RFID) provides technical support for PHCtracking. In this paper, technical and economic analysis has been carried out byRFID application and cost-benefit analysis. RFID-based PHC tracking system hasbeen designed, which has two core module-location tracking module, installschedule and quality monitoring module. PHC location tracking methods andinstall schedule and quality monitoring methods have been designed for real timeinformation collection and monitoring, such as production, supply and installationinformation. Designed equipment selection and label coding principles, given theoverall steps for system achievement.Technology acceptance model (TAM) is used for influence factors analysis ofRFID-based PHC tracking system. In this paper, there are five factors have beenidentified-technology, organization, external environment, perceived usefulnessand ease-of-use,13research hypothesis have been analyzed. It’s found thatperceived usefulness is the most important factor; other factors all have directinfluence on the attitude of using this system.RFID-based tracking system is designed for real time PHC informationcollection and analysis, which also provide an advanced method for improving theefficiency of prefabricating housing construction enterprises’ management.
